Abstract
The NA52 experiment searched for long-lived charged strangelets in 158 A GeV/c Pb+Pb collisions at CERN SPS. We collected 1013 Pb+Pb interactions looking for negatively charged strangelets and 3 × 10 11 Pb+Pb interactions for positively charged ones. No evidence for the production of strangelets has been observed. The upper strangelet production limits are discussed. Besides the strangelet searches NA52 was able to identify particles and anti-particles over a wide range in rapidity. Results of the invariant differential particle production cross sections including fragments up to carbon and 5 3̄He are presented.
